Migrate JIRA project from one server to another

francois vlerick September 14, 2018

Hi all

 

I'd like to migrate some jira projects from a instance (6.3.11 server) to my Cloud instance. 

 

Which is the best mean? 

 

I'm quite sure I'll have a few configuration matters (workflows, screens), but this is quite easy to fix... My concern is more about 

    How to export versions / components and then issues from jira 6.3.11 server?  

 

   How to import them in Jira Cloud?

In theory there are 3 main steps..

  1. You upgrade to the latest version of JIRA (since Cloud is similar to that and that is recommendation)
  2. Backup and Export data from your JIRA Server
  3. Import data to JIRA Cloud

Then you see what kind of errors you get :)

I suggest to start with this documentation:
